If I had my choice I would start with the Coolsat 7000 it has blind scan capabilities and a 36" motorized dish will get you going fine.
You will miss out on the HD channels and some others that require DVBS2..So once your set up and see whats up there in the clear you might want to pick up an inexpensive Openbox S9 to view the HD and other channels.

I have a Coolsat7000 as well and I found that the factory file was not up to date and needed a 3rd party file to get an updated N/A sat listing then all was well. Using my CS7000 to control my 1m(39") dish with a Standard Dual output Linear LNB. FTA channels are on many sats so a motorized dish is a must.
